Step 1: Choose the option to add a general journal entry from the given Company menu. Enter the present date and allocate a number to the entry. Step 2: Now, debit the particular payroll liability account for the adjusted amount. Step 3: Credit the given payroll expense account that you wish to adjust.

WebCity of Seattle-LTA. PO Box 34907. Seattle, WA 98124-1907. The payroll expense tax in 2024 is required of businesses with: $8,135,746 or more of payroll expense in Seattle for the past calendar year (2024), and. compensation in Seattle for the current calendar year (2024) paid to at least one employee whose annual compensation is $174,337 or more.
